#1b632b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1b632b is composed of 10.6% red, 38.8% green and 16.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 56.6%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 133.3 degrees, a saturation of 57.1% and a lightness of 24.7%. #1b632b color hex could be obtained by blending #36c656 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

● #1b632b color description : Very dark lime green.
#1b632b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1b632b has RGB values of R:27, G:99, B:43 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0, Y:0.57,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 1794859.

Shades and Tints of #1b632b
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020703 is the darkest color, while #f6fd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b632b
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d413e is the less saturated color, while #037b1e is the most saturated one.
